Output 89125c22811f0123f150b1fcfa7993091a4662c557acdb144d6f7bd22baaf591:21
- value
- 750946
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b645afd2d84cc4342fbf192bab21d5ab2a3311ee OP_EQUAL
- address
- 3JJnPP5HpUaK3yoBfr6G8zZL18AV8TaxqS
- transaction
- 89125c22811f0123f150b1fcfa7993091a4662c557acdb144d6f7bd22baaf591